Sincerely, Brenda Lee is the sixth studio album by American pop and country artist Brenda Lee.
Sincerely, Brenda Lee was recorded in five separate sessions at the Bradley Film and Recording Studio in Nashville, Tennessee, United States under the direction of Owen Bradley.[citation needed] The first session began on January 8, 1961 and the last session took place on October 28, 1961 ... The album was released February 12, 1962 on Decca Records ..... it peaked at #29 on the Billboard 200 albums chart.

Track A6 has two titles:
"Thrills Of Your Love" (on early issues of the album)
"The Thrill Of Your Love."
Which is the correct title?
The later, "The Thrill Of Your Love," confirmed by the score to this Stanley Kester song (link below).
